MGM Resorts (NASDAQ: MGM) has performed strongly over the past couple of years, with over 8% annual growth in revenue and a 49% jump in the stock price in between 2015-2017. The strong growth was largely due to robust performance in the domestic market, in addition to the full operational year of MGM National Harbor. As a result, the company’s domestic market gross revenue grew to roughly $9.2 billion (+18% y-o-y)). We are optimistic about MGM’s 2018, primarily due to the healthy environment in Macau – its entry into the Cotai region earlier in the year, as well as a recovery in the Vegas market, should provide long-term growth opportunities.

We have arrived at a $40 price estimate for MGM’s stock, which is nearly 14% ahead of the market price, based on revenue projections of nearly $12 billion for 2018, net income margin of 15%,and a P/E multiple of 13x, which is slightly higher than the figure for 2017, but still lower than the industry average.

We expect the domestic market to remain the driving force led by a recovery in the Vegas market, and its expansion into Massachusetts should provide long-term growth opportunities. In addition, we also expect a strong growth opportunity for MGM in Macau, driven by the tailwinds in the Macau casino market. MGM’s CEO Jim Murren is optimistic about the legalization of sports gambling as well, and we expect this to boost its domestic operations.
